Obstacles Facing the Market

In spite of the promising development and chances, the Spanish painkiller market deals with a number of challenges:

  1. Regulatory Constraints: The pharmaceutical industry is heavily controlled. Changes in policies can affect the accessibility and prices of pain relievers. For example, stricter controls on opioid prescriptions have modified the dynamics of the marketplace.

  2. Dependence Issues: An increasing focus on the opioid crisis has actually led to a growing public and governmental examination of painkillers, especially opioid-based medications. This has actually led to a shift towards non-opioid alternatives in pain management.

  3. Market Competition: The competitive landscape in Spain is magnifying, with both international gamers and local providers contending for market share. This pressure can impact pricing and sales strategies.

  4. Customer Perception: There is an ongoing challenge to shift consumer understanding regarding pain management-- informing clients about the advantages of both prescription and OTC options while dealing with issues about dependence and adverse effects.

Future Trends

The future landscape of the painkiller market in Spain is likely to be affected by a number of emerging patterns:

  1. Telehealth: The rise of telemedicine may assist in simpler access to pain management consultations, enabling patients to receive prompt prescriptions and alternative options.

  2. Biologics: There is growing interest in biologic pain relief options, which target particular pathways associated with pain perception, offering new hope for clients struggling with persistent pain.

  3. Digital Health Solutions: Mobile applications and wearable gadgets that assist track pain levels or medication use might become integral to pain management methods, improving adherence and outcomes.

  4. Personalized Medicine: There is an increasing concentrate on establishing tailored pain management strategies customized to specific patient requirements, consisting of genetic factors that can affect drug effectiveness and safety.
